Abstract

The embodiments of the present invention relate to a method, terminal, device and system for achieving carrier load balancing. The method for achieving carrier load balancing includes: mapping a terminal onto a reverse carrier by way of a mapping algorithm within the scope of part of or all of the reverse carriers, wherein one reverse carrier onto which the terminal is mapped corresponds to a plurality of forward carriers; and mapping the terminal onto a forward carrier in part of or all of the forward carriers by way of a mapping algorithm within the scope of part of or all of the forward carriers. Therefore, each terminal is mapped onto a reverse carrier by way of a mapping algorithm when a large number of M2M applications or smart terminals use the random access channel. Due to the uniformity or the equal probability characteristic of the mapping algorithm, it is ensured that the numbers of terminals mapped onto various reverse carriers are similar or even the same, such that the numbers of terminals initiating random access on various reverse carriers are similar or even the same as far as possible, i.e. the loads among various random access channels are balanced, achieving load balancing among various reverse carriers.

technical field [0001] The present invention relates to the technical field of wireless communication, in particular to a method, terminal, device and system for realizing carrier load balancing. Background technique [0002] In a wireless communication system, a terminal often adopts a contention-based random access method to achieve reverse access. Since the reverse access channel is a single shared channel, and each terminal device can randomly initiate the access process according to its own wishes, if two or more terminal devices send access information at the same time, the uplink of the air interface Signals will interfere with each other, causing the receiving end to fail to correctly identify each sending end signal. This situation is called random access collision. The way to solve the collision is to back off for a period of time and then initiate an access attempt until the access is successful or the maximum number of access attempts is reached.
